INA - BAGHDAD
Iraqi Civil Aviation Authority - ICAA announced on Monday, electing of Iraq as Chairman of the Air Safety Committee in the Arab Civil Aviation Organization.
The Air Safety Committee in the Arab Civil Aviation Organization elected the Director of Air Safety in the Iraqi Civil Aviation Authority, Ali Nima Rasham, as its head in its current session, according to a statement by ICAA received by the Iraqi News Agency (INA).
"This event is important for Iraq's role and position in the Arab Civil Aviation Organization through its prominent presence in international meetings and conferences, which will enhance air safety work mechanisms and its effective role with member states,” included the statement.
For his part, the Director of Air Safety in the Iraqi Civil Aviation Authority praised the distinguished role and continuous follow-up by the President of the Iraqi Civil Aviation Authority, Captain Nael Saad Abdul Hadi, in order to activate the role of air safety before international aviation organizations and bodies, as this is an achievement in addition to the work of the Civil Aviation Authority.
